Abstract
In this work, it is demonstrated that the performance of a satellite network can be optimized by changing its facilities. A mesh connected, circuit switched satellite communication network is shown to perform better by adaptively reconfiguring the network by using simulated annealing to suit the current traffic conditions. Proper allocation of link capacities and placing an optimal reservation scheme for the network are crucial in this scheme. Routing is performed dynamically. Simulation results confirm these characteristics.
